have owned this car for 6 years,business endeavors are a higher priority,so, for sale is my 72 satellite. car was a mountain home idaho-high desert car till it was brought here to KY. has small bubbles starting on lower doors where trim holes were filled. no rust anywhere else,and never has had. all original sheet-metal everywhere. paint is a good 20-footer,driver quality at best. original 318/auto/bench/column car. everything underneath that would unbolt,was either restored or replaced. all suspension components,K-frame,trans cross,all parts were steel-shot blast and black powdercoated. new mopar front sway bar was added,new mopar .920 torsion bars,all new MOOG suspension,everything. all new brakes,every part,only thing reused were the spindles and caliper brackets,which were also shot-blast and powdercoated. 8 3/4 rear,completely rebuilt drum to drum,new green bearings,new drums,hardware,shoes,cylinders,everything.rebuilt sure-grip with 3.23 gears.repro rear sway bar,bushings and brackets, new mopar performance XHD leaf springs,shackles,u-bolts,etc. all new brake and fuel lines front to rear. new year one gas tank,fuel sending unit.
power is fresh '68 440. standard bore,completely rebuilt. 40+hours port work on original 906 heads,stock size manley valves,back-cut. original iron intake and magnum manifolds,both were sent out and extrude-honed inside. edelbrock 750 carb,XE-268 comp cam,valve springs,lock,retainers,double roller chain.mopar performance hi-volume oil pump,milodon 8-quart pan and pick-up,new,vintage gold moroso valve covers and 14" breather.MP ignition kit,orange-box,performance distibutor,msd coil. MP orange plug wires. holley performance mechanical fuel pump and regulator.exhaust is 2 1/2" aluminized duals,DR.gas X-pipe,flowmaster 40 series american thunders,tail pipes exit turn-down under rear valance. new 26" radiator,milodon hi-volume water pump,MP 7-blade fan/clutch. 180 thermostat. car runs dead on 180 even on 97+ degree days here in traffic. 68' 727,professionally rebuilt. new 2400 big-end racing converter.new driveshaft with new u-joints.interior is almost done,buckets,console,slap-stick now.floor shift column,has all new year one legendary seat covers,new year one ACC carpet,dash has cap,have all new in box year-one AM soffseal weather-stripping,headliner,package tray,truck mat,etc. has great,driver quality black upper/lower door pannels and all interior trim including sail-panels. has rallye dash with clock,wiring harness is from a 73-electronic ignition/rallye dash,buckets/console B-body. has reproduction set of aluminum rear window louvers,repop go-wing,chin spoilers,black reflective strobe stripe. dual painted mirrors,vintage wagner yellow high-beam foglite bulbs. wheels and tires are american racing 15X7 torq-thrust D's with new goodyear radials. car runs and drives fabulous. jump in and drive anywhere you want,anytime.alot of time and money spent on this car,needs light finishing. drive while you finish. nice straight,99.9% rust-free and very quick driver. here is a photobucket link to pics: http://s207.photobucket.com/albums/bb102/superbyrd/my72plym2010/ be glad to take pics of any part of the car,never any rust underneath,trunk,floors,nowhere. dry car. car is located in henderson,ky 42420. asking $12,500.00 or offer. call 270-860-2323 with questions or e-mail: [email protected]
